Output 571d8fafa86a96a465bbde719f3bb248106078304b988e6adc682d5f0a18e92f:1

value
8960310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eadc24fc74c2bbe2c18fe59de472d87cc0a8e4b OP_EQUAL
address
37QRyRgH7CELts2KaaXUiwMhF88tNFvL4F
transaction
571d8fafa86a96a465bbde719f3bb248106078304b988e6adc682d5f0a18e92f
spent
true